What is an air transformer called?
An air transformer is also commonly called an air core transformer. Unlike traditional transformers that use a ferromagnetic core made of materials like iron or steel, an air-floated transformer uses air as the core material. Instead of a solid core, the windings of an air-core transformer are wound around a hollow cylindrical or toroidal structure, allowing the passage of air through the center. Air swim transformers are used in applications where low core losses, high frequency operation and minimal electromagnetic interference are required. They are commonly used in radio frequency (RF) and high frequency (HF) applications, where they provide efficient coupling and high bandwidth.
